Reasons for gender change in Pune

There are several reasons why individuals in Pune may choose to undergo gender change or sex reassignment Some common reasons include:

Gender dysphoria: Gender dysphoria is a condition where an individual experiences distress or discomfort due to a mismatch between their gender identity and their assigned sex at birth. This can lead to feelings of depression, social isolation. Gender change may be a way for individuals to alleviate these feelings and live authentically as their true gender.

Social stigma and discrimination: Transgender individuals in Pune face widespread discrimination and social stigma, which can have a profound impact on their mental health and wellbeing. Gender change may be a way for individuals to escape this discrimination and live a more fulfilling life without fear of rejection or violence.

Access to healthcare: Many transgender individuals in Pune struggle to access adequate healthcare, particularly gender-affirming healthcare. Gender change may be a way for individuals to access the medical care they need to transition and live as their true gender.

Cultural and religious factors: In some cultures and religions, there are traditional or spiritual beliefs that support gender change or non-binary gender identities. For example, some Hijra communities in Pune have a long history of recognizing a third gender, and individuals may choose to undergo gender change to align with this identity.

Personal identity and expression: Ultimately, the decision to undergo gender change is a deeply personal one, driven by an individual’s own sense of identity and expression. For some, gender change may be a way to feel more authentic and true to themselves, regardless of societal norms or expectations.

Documents required for gender change in Pune

Documents required for gender change in Pune

The documents required for gender change in Pune may vary depending on the state and region. However, here is a general list of the documents that may be required:

Medical certificate: A medical certificate from a qualified medical professional is typically required to diagnose gender dysphoria and recommend hormone therapy or gender-affirming surgeries.

Court order: A court order is required to legally change one’s gender in Pune. This may require filing a petition with the district court and providing various documents, such as the medical certificate, court fees, and an affidavit stating that the gender change is not for fraudulent or illegal purposes.

Identity proof: Once legal documentation is obtained, individuals must update their identity documents, such as their passport, driving license, and voter ID, to reflect their new gender. This may also require additional documentation, such as a court order or a letter from a medical professional.

Photographs: Recent passport-sized photographs may be required for updating identity documents.

Process Of Gender Change in Pune

The procedure to publish a gazette notification for gender change in Pune

This involves the following steps.

Obtain a court order:

The first step is to obtain a court order allowing for the change of gender. This typically involves filing a petition with the district court and providing various documents, such as a medical certificate, court fees, and an affidavit stating that the gender change is not for fraudulent or illegal purposes.

Submit an application to the Department of Publication:

Once the court order is obtained, an application must be submitted to the Department of Publication of the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s. The application must include a copy of the court order, a passport-sized photograph, and a demand draft for the prescribed fee.

Verification of documents:

The Department of Publication will verify the documents submitted with the application and issue a verification certificate if everything is in order.

Gender change Affidavit

Affidavit of gender change must be created. In the affidavit, the reason for the change must be specified.

Newspaper Publication

Newspaper publication is important, if you want to change your gender.

Publication in the Gazette of Pune:

Once the verification certificate is obtained, the gazette notification can be published. The Department of Publication will publish the notification in the Gazette of Pune, the official government publication. The notification will include the individual’s name, former gender, and new gender, as well as any other relevant details.

Update identity documents:

Once the gazette notification is published, individuals can update their identity documents, such as their passport, driving license, and voter ID, to reflect their new gender.

    Preparation for gender change surgery in Pune

    The preparation for gender change surgery in Pune can vary depending on the type of surgery and the individual’s specific needs and medical history. However, here are some general steps that may be involved:

    Consultation with a medical professional:

    The first step is typically to consult with a qualified medical professional, such as a urologist, gynaecologist, or plastic surgeon, who specializes in gender-affirming surgeries. The medical professional will evaluate the individual’s medical history and recommend the most appropriate surgery based on their needs.

    Hormone therapy:

    In some cases, hormone therapy may be recommended prior to surgery to help feminize or masculinize the body and prepare it for surgery.

    Psychological evaluation:

    In addition to the medical evaluation, a psychological evaluation may be required to assess the individual’s mental health and readiness for surgery.

    Pre-operative testing:

    Before surgery, the individual may undergo various tests and screenings to ensure they are healthy enough to undergo the procedure. This may include blood tests, imaging tests, and other diagnostic tests.

    Preparation for recovery:

    The individual will need to prepare for the recovery period after surgery, which may involve taking time off from work or school, arranging post-operative care, and making necessary modifications to their living environment.

    Post-operative care:

    Following surgery, the individual will require ongoing care and monitoring, including follow-up visits with their medical provider and physical therapy.
